package memorytopo
import (
"context"
"fmt"
"vitess.io/vitess/go/vt/topo"
)
// Watch is part of the topo.Conn interface.
func (c *Conn) Watch(ctx context.Context, filePath string) (*topo.WatchData, <-chan *topo.WatchData, error) {
if c.closed {
return nil, nil, ErrConnectionClosed
}
c.factory.Lock()
defer c.factory.Unlock()
if c.factory.err != nil {
return nil, nil, c.factory.err
}
n := c.factory.nodeByPath(c.cell, filePath)
if n == nil {
return nil, nil, topo.NewError(topo.NoNode, filePath)
}
if n.contents == nil {
// it's a directory
return nil, nil, fmt.Errorf("cannot watch directory %v in cell %v", filePath, c.cell)
}
current := &topo.WatchData{
Contents: n.contents,
Version: NodeVersion(n.version),
}
notifications := make(chan *topo.WatchData, 100)
watchIndex := nextWatchIndex
nextWatchIndex++
n.watches[watchIndex] = watch{contents: notifications}
go func() {
<-ctx.Done()
// This function can be called at any point, so we first need
// to make sure the watch is still valid.
c.factory.Lock()
defer c.factory.Unlock()
n := c.factory.nodeByPath(c.cell, filePath)
if n == nil {
return
}
if w, ok := n.watches[watchIndex]; ok {
delete(n.watches, watchIndex)
w.contents <- &topo.WatchData{Err: topo.NewError(topo.Interrupted, "watch")}
close(w.contents)
}
}()
return current, notifications, nil
}
// WatchRecursive is part of the topo.Conn interface.
func (c *Conn) WatchRecursive(ctx context.Context, dirpath string) ([]*topo.WatchDataRecursive, <-chan *topo.WatchDataRecursive, error) {
if c.closed {
return nil, nil, ErrConnectionClosed
}
c.factory.Lock()
defer c.factory.Unlock()
if c.factory.err != nil {
return nil, nil, c.factory.err
}
n := c.factory.getOrCreatePath(c.cell, dirpath)
if n == nil {
return nil, nil, topo.NewError(topo.NoNode, dirpath)
}
var initialwd []*topo.WatchDataRecursive
n.recurseContents(func(n *node) {
initialwd = append(initialwd, &topo.WatchDataRecursive{
Path: n.name,
WatchData: topo.WatchData{
Contents: n.contents,
Version: NodeVersion(n.version),
},
})
})
notifications := make(chan *topo.WatchDataRecursive, 100)
watchIndex := nextWatchIndex
nextWatchIndex++
n.watches[watchIndex] = watch{recursive: notifications}
go func() {
defer close(notifications)
<-ctx.Done()
c.factory.Lock()
f := c.factory
defer f.Unlock()
n := f.nodeByPath(c.cell, dirpath)
if n != nil {
delete(n.watches, watchIndex)
}
notifications <- &topo.WatchDataRecursive{WatchData: topo.WatchData{Err: topo.NewError(topo.Interrupted, "watch")}}
}()
return initialwd, notifications, nil
}
